Transaction 38069306b494f3989c1926abaa11de93e5969614b9a8e32e53547e19a83b70a5

1 Input
2 Outputs
  • 38069306b494f3989c1926abaa11de93e5969614b9a8e32e53547e19a83b70a5:0
  • value  8915113253
    address  2Muktr23gPMfEf99EbFhBnPSHhwTRXruxV1
  • 38069306b494f3989c1926abaa11de93e5969614b9a8e32e53547e19a83b70a5:1
  • value  1552838
    address  2MzAxnZMPK2kzMjohH8T89VkJSJfQLDWrWa